This distribution also includes a launcher executable, also named ``west``.
|
||||
When west is installed, the launcher is placed by :file:`pip3` somewhere in the
|
||||
user's filesystem (exactly where depends on the operating system, but should be
|
||||
on the ``PATH`` :ref:`environment variable <env_vars>`). This launcher is the
|
||||
command-line entry point.
